Sex and the City stars Cynthia Nixon and Kristin Davis have recalled how they landed their roles on the show, revealing they were both invited to audition for Carrie Bradshaw.

The iconic role ultimately went to Sarah Jessica Parker, however in an episode of And Just Like That… The Writers Room podcast the pair discussed how they were asked to read for the part.

Davis shared that SATC creator Darren Star already had Parker in mind for the role at the time but asked her to audition anyway, saying: "We really wanted Sarah Jessica…[but] we don’t know if Sarah’s going to do it, so will you read for Carrie?"

However Davis quickly realised that she was better suited for her eventual role as Charlotte York and convinced Star to let her try out for the part.

"The original script, Carrie was much more like Candice and she smoked and she swore," she said, adding that she told Star: "I can’t even read for Carrie. I am this other girl who’s like underwritten but I understand her. I need to be her."

Nixon, who plays lawyer Miranda Hobbes, then revealed that her first audition for Carrie didn't go particularly well. "I auditioned and they were like, ‘Yeah, not so much," she said.

The actress went on to add that she was invited back to read for Miranda, a process which took several months.

Recalling a conversation her agent had with show producers, Nixon said she was told that she was "top of the list" for the role but executives weren't ready to cast her.

However, after months of following up she was finally offered the role of Miranda, with Parker signing on as Carrie soon after. The trio, alongside Kim Cattrall's Samantha Jones, starred in the NYC based show for six seasons.

Parker, Nixon and Davis later reprised their roles for the highly anticipated spin-off series And Just Like That.

Cattrall initially declined to take part in the show, before later agreeing to film a cameo for the upcoming season.
